The invention discloses a vehicle self-positioning method serving four-wheel steering intelligent parking, and belongs to the technical field of intelligent parking. The method comprises the following steps: stp1, acquiring wheel speed pulses, wheel speeds and wheel movement direction signals of four tires, and acquiring a front wheel rotation angle delta F and a rear wheel rotation angle delta R; stp2, constructing a four-wheel steering model under a low-speed working condition; stp3, calculating a vehicle driving distance and a course angle at the virtual rear axle center point O1; stp4, calculating the position information of the central point O1 of the virtual rear axle; and Stp5, according to the vehicle position information and course angle information at the virtual rear axle center, calculating real-time position information of the front axle center point and the rear axle center point O1 in real time. The method is used for calculating a vehicle self-positioning algorithm of a four-wheel steering system at a low speed in real time and outputting position information of a vehicle in real time in a mode of constructing the virtual rear axle center point.
